Avispa Fukuoka were relegated to the J. League second division for their third time following a 3-1 away defeat to Albirex Niigata on Sunday.

Dead-last Avispa, the first J1 club to be sent down this year, were taken off life support with four games left in the season after suffering their 22nd defeat in 30 matches as Isao Homma struck only two minutes into the game at Big Swan stadium.

Cho Young Cheol scored a second-half brace to put the game out of reach for Tetsuya Asano's side, which pulled one back with two minutes remaining through Yutaka Takahashi.
